I'd been meaning to check out Saikano: The Last Love Song On This Little Planet (or as it's apparently now [somewhat misleadingly] called, She, The Ultimate Weapon [makes it sound like an action show with a heavy side of fanservice, which is about the farthest thing from what it is]) for years. I saw that it was on Hulu a few months ago, but had other things to watch at the time so I put it off; then a few days ago I looked at my watchlist and saw that it was being taken down in the next round of their idiotic anime purge, so I binged it.

    I'm now contemplating suicide.

    Not really, but damn. This thing is more or less a sci-fi version of Grave of the Fireflies. Highly recommended (as long as you don't mind being too sad to even cry).
